前言
angular-library-name
是一个 Angular 的开源库。库中包含了一些基础的组件和功能,可以帮助 Angular 开发者快速构建应用。该库在 npm 上是高度可配置的,也容易使用,所以它被广泛使用。
本篇教程将详细介绍如何使用 angular-library-name
库。教程分为两个部分:库的安装和基本用法指导。读者需要提前了解一些 Angular 的基础知识。
安装
可以通过 npm 安装 angular-library-name
库:
npm install angular-library-name
基本用法
导入
angular-library-name
库中包含了一些 Angular 组件和服务。在使用之前,需要先导入需要的组件和服务:
import { ComponentName, ServiceName } from "angular-library-name";
使用组件
angular-library-name
库中包含了一些常用的组件,如 Button
、Input
等。可以通过以下方式在 Angular 组件中使用:
import { Button } from "angular-library-name"; @Component({ selector: "app-sample", template: `<library-button>Click Me</library-button>`, }) export class SampleComponent {}
使用服务
angular-library-name
库中还包含了一些服务,如 HttpService
、AuthService
等。可以通过以下方式在 Angular 组件中使用:
-- -------------------- ---- ------- ------ - ----------- - ---- ----------------------- ------------ --------- ------------- --------- ------ -- ------ ----- --------------- - ------------------- ----- ------------ -- -
配置
angular-library-name
库提供了一些配置选项,开发者可以根据自己的需求进行配置。这些配置选项可以通过代码或者配置文件进行设置。以下是一些常用的配置选项:
样式
angular-library-name
库中的组件是通过 Sass 进行样式编写的,开发者可以修改组件样式以适应自己的项目需求。可以通过以下代码将自定义样式添加到组件中:
@import "angular-library-name/styles"; .custom-button { @extend .library-button; background-color: red; }
路由
angular-library-name
库中的一些组件是有路由需求的,如果没有配置正确的路由,将会出现渲染问题。可以通过以下代码在项目中添加路由:
-- -------------------- ---- ------- ------ - -------- - ---- ---------------- ------ - ------------ - ---- ------------------ ------ - --------------- - ---- ----------------------- ----------- ------------- ------------------ -------- - ----------------------- - ----- --- ---------- ---------------- -- --- -- -- ------ ----- ------------- --
国际化
angular-library-name
库提供了多语言支持功能,开发者可以根据自己的需求进行国际化。以下是一个简单的例子:
-- -------------------- ---- ------- ------ - -------- - ---- ---------------- ------ - --------------- - ---- ---------------------- ----------- -------- - ------------------------- ---------------- ----- ------- - -------- ---------------- ----------- ------------------ ----- ------------- -- --- -- -- ------ ----- ------------- --
总结
在本篇文章中,我们介绍了 angular-library-name
库的基本用法及配置。该库广泛使用,并且在开源社区中受到欢迎。我们建议开发者在项目中使用这个库,以提高开发效率。
@Component({ selector: "app-sample", template: `<library-button>Click Me</library-button>`, }) export class SampleComponent {}
同时,我们还提供了一些设置选项以帮助开发者更好地适应他们的项目需求。希望该教程可以帮助 Angular 开发者使用 angular-library-name
库。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600557a681e8991b448d4a98